[Issue 15978] Can't pass array or vector .init as template parameter

d-bugmail at puremagic.com d-bugmail at puremagic.com
Sun Feb 19 21:33:54 UTC 2023


https://issues.dlang.org/show_bug.cgi?id=15978

Nick Treleaven <nick at geany.org>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|nick at geany.org
            Summary|Can't pass vector.init as   |Can't pass array or vector
                   |template parameter          |.init as template parameter

--- Comment #1 from Nick Treleaven <nick at geany.org> ---
Not just __vector:

alias a = MyTemplate!(int.init); // OK
alias a = MyTemplate!(int[].init); // NG
alias a = MyTemplate!(int[4].init); // NG

--


More information about the Digitalmars-d-bugs mailing list